Ballindoolin House & Garden

Co. Kildare, Ireland

Originally built in 1822 - the large working walled kitchen garden, and pleasure gardens were completely restored in 1998/9 by the Molony family. It is now a very important Irish garden. Visitors also enjoy woodland nature trails, restaurant, children's farmyard, and museum.

Royal Horticultural Garden

DK-1870 Frederiksberg C, Denmark

A botanical garden, primarily for students and teachers at the Royal Agricultural University, secondarily a park open to the public. Established in 1858, 35 acres with 5.000 species and cultivars. Large beddingplant selection - every year 800 on display.

Chateau du Colombier Eden Medieval

Salles La Source, France

Medieval Castle and Eden Garden, an enchanting collection of ornamental, aromatic, dye and condimentary plants known before 1450. Old Rose Garden, "Courtly Love Maze". Wisteria Arbor. Ostii et Rockii Peony Terraces. Rare trees and shrubs. Giant Chessboard, bowls, croquet.
